- The distance between Bora-Bora Vataipe, French Polynesia and Gedaref/ Azaza, Sudan is approximately 19,203 km or 11,933 mi.
- To reach Bora-Bora Vataipe in this distance one would set out from Gedaref/ Azaza bearing 110.1°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Bora-Bora Vataipe bearing 71.8° or ENE .
- Bora-Bora Vataipe has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am) whereas Gedaref/ Azaza has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h).
- The average annual temperature is 1.9 °C (3.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.8 °C (8.6°F) less in Bora-Bora Vataipe.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1302.3 mm (51.3 in) more which is equivalent to 1302.3 l/m² (31.96 US gal/ft²) or 13,023,000 l/ha (1,392,245 US gal/ac) more. About 3 1/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 2° lower in Bora-Bora Vataipe than in Gedaref/ Azaza.
